The Supreme Court's decision to overturn Roe v. Wade was dehumanizing and dangerous. It does not reflect the will of the majority of Americans who deeply value control over their own bodies. As leader of the State senate in Vermont, I worked to make sure that my State was the first in the Nation to explicitly protect reproductive freedoms in its constitution. It is time to provide these same protections for all Americans. While Republicans seek to control women's bodies to try to distract us from their extreme stances with farcical resolutions, my Democratic colleagues and I will not stop until reproductive freedoms are restored as the law of the land. The American people are overwhelmingly with us. They want their rights. They want their freedoms. As a woman, as a mother, as a Congresswoman, I will continue to fight for a world where abortion care is legal, safe, and accessible for all Americans. ____________________
